Question 1002572: Find the slope of the line passing through the given points

(-4,-1),(-1,-7)

x1 y1 x2 y2
-4 -1 -1 -7

slope m = (y2-y1)/(x2-x1)
( -7 - -1 )/( -1 - -4 )
( -6 / 3 )
m= -2
The required line passes through both the points. So we select one point and plug it with the slope
Plug value of the slope and point ( -4 , -1 ) in
Y = m x + b
-1.00 = -2 * -4 + b
-1.00 = 8 + b
b= -1 + -8
b= -9
So the equation will be
Y = -2 x -9
